Full Description
Before March 2012. Metal-detecting.
One Late Saxon stirrup terminal (S1), an incomplete Medieval harness mount, a Medieval seal matrix (S1, S2), three fragments of 14th to 17th century copper alloy cooking vessels, a medieval or post-medieval lead weight, a 17th century dress fastener, and a Post Medieval coin weight.
